POS hardware, or point of sale hardware, refers to the physical components that make up a point of sale system These components typically include a cash register, barcode scanner, receipt printer, and payment terminal In the past, POS hardware was bulky, expensive, and difficult to use However, advances in technology have led to the development of sleek, user-friendly POS systems that are revolutionizing the retail experience.
One of the most significant developments in POS hardware is the shift towards cloud-based systems Cloud-based POS systems operate on the internet, allowing retailers to access real-time data from anywhere in the world This means that business owners can track sales, inventory levels, and customer behavior in real-time, enabling them to make informed decisions about their operations Cloud-based POS systems are also more secure than traditional systems, as data is stored off-site and encrypted to prevent unauthorized access.
Another key innovation in POS hardware is the integration of mobile technology Many retailers are now using tablets and smartphones as part of their POS systems, allowing sales associates to process transactions on the shop floor rather than behind a checkout counter This not only improves the customer experience by reducing wait times but also gives sales associates the freedom to engage with customers and provide personalized recommendations.
In addition to cloud-based systems and mobile technology, modern POS hardware is also becoming more customizable and adaptable to different business needs pos hardware. For example, some POS systems allow retailers to integrate loyalty programs, gift cards, and promotions directly into their checkout process This not only helps to increase customer loyalty but also provides valuable data about customer preferences and purchasing behavior.
Furthermore, many POS hardware providers are now offering subscription-based pricing models, making it easier for small businesses to afford the latest technology Instead of paying a large upfront cost for hardware and software, retailers can now pay a monthly fee for access to a fully integrated POS system This not only reduces the financial burden on businesses but also ensures that they always have access to the latest features and updates.
With the rise of e-commerce and omnichannel retailing, POS hardware is also evolving to meet the changing needs of consumers For example, some POS systems now offer integrations with online marketplaces and social media platforms, allowing retailers to sell their products through multiple channels This not only expands their reach to new customers but also provides a seamless shopping experience for those who prefer to shop online.
